As mobile applications evolve, integrating advanced features that enhance user experience has become crucial for developers. One trending topic capturing the attention of both app developers and users alike is the integration of artificial intelligence (AI) and machine learning (ML) into app features. These technologies are reshaping how applications interact with users, offering personalized experiences and improving overall functionality.
The rise of AI and ML in mobile apps is largely driven by the demand for personalization. Users today expect their apps to adapt to their preferences and behaviors seamlessly. By utilizing machine learning algorithms, developers can analyze user data to tailor recommendations, notifications, and interfaces. This not only enhances user engagement but also fosters customer loyalty, as users feel valued when apps cater to their specific needs.
One exciting example of AI integration is the use of chatbots in messaging applications. Chatbots can provide instant responses, assist with inquiries, and even facilitate transactions. This interactive feature elevates customer service and enriches the user experience. By implementing natural language processing, chatbots can understand user queries better and respond more appropriately, making interactions smoother and more efficient.
Additionally, AI-powered virtual assistants are becoming increasingly prevalent within mobile applications. These assistants can help users manage their schedules, set reminders, and perform various tasks hands-free. With voice recognition technology improving steadily, users can interact with these assistants in a more natural way. The result is a more convenient experience, allowing users to multitask without needing to navigate through multiple app interfaces.
Another emerging feature is predictive text input, which has become a staple in messaging and email applications. Machine learning algorithms analyze user typing patterns to suggest words and phrases, significantly speeding up communication. This feature not only enhances the typing experience but also reduces errors, making conversations flow more naturally. By understanding user behavior, these algorithms contribute to a more streamlined interaction with apps.
In the realm of content consumption, AI is transforming how users discover new media. Music and video streaming services employ algorithms that analyze listening or viewing habits to recommend personalized content. This tailored approach keeps users engaged longer, as they are continually presented with materials aligned with their tastes. Personalization through AI can increase user satisfaction and service appreciation, leading to a higher likelihood of subscription renewals.
Furthermore, the incorporation of augmented reality (AR) into apps is gaining traction, particularly in sectors like retail and gaming. AR enhances user engagement by overlaying digital content onto the real world, creating immersive experiences. For instance, furniture retail apps allow users to visualize how a piece of furniture would look in their home before making a purchase. This practical application of AR not only boosts user confidence in decisions but also reduces return rates.
The trend towards gamification, where traditional processes are infused with game-like elements, is also growing in popularity. By incorporating leaderboards, rewards, and challenges, developers can create engaging experiences that motivate users to interact more with their apps. Gamification taps into users’ competitive spirits, making mundane tasks feel more rewarding. This trend can be seen in fitness apps, where users earn rewards for completing workouts or achieving goals.
Privacy and security are paramount concerns for users today, and app developers are responding by implementing advanced security features. Biometric authentication, such as fingerprint or facial recognition, is becoming standard practice for securing sensitive data. Users appreciate the convenience and added layer of protection that biometrics offer. This not only enhances user trust but also complies with increasingly stringent data protection regulations.
As the demand for simplified user interfaces continues to grow, developers are investing in the design of minimalistic yet functional app layouts. A clean, intuitive interface improves user experience by making navigation straightforward and seamless. Users are more likely to engage with applications that require fewer steps to accomplish tasks. This trend underlines the importance of user-centered design principles in app development.
Accessibility features are also becoming essential in app development, ensuring inclusivity for all users. This includes options for adjusting text size, color contrast, and voice commands. By considering the diverse needs of users, developers can create applications that cater to individuals with disabilities. Enhancing accessibility not only broadens the user base but also showcases a brand’s commitment to social responsibility.
The integration of IoT (Internet of Things) into mobile applications is another noteworthy trend affecting app functionality. Smart home devices, wearables, and other IoT technology can be controlled and monitored through dedicated mobile apps. This seamless connection between devices enhances user convenience and enriches the overall experience. Users appreciate the ability to manage their smart devices from one central application, fostering a cohesive ecosystem.
Furthermore, the rise of subscription models in mobile applications is reshaping revenue strategies for developers. By offering premium features through subscription plans, developers can provide ongoing support and updates. This model not only generates continuous revenue but also fosters a long-term relationship with users. As users become accustomed to receiving new features and improvements regularly, their engagement and loyalty are likely to increase.
In the context of community-building within apps, social features are becoming vital. Many applications now incorporate social sharing options, allowing users to connect with friends and share achievements. This not only enhances the social experience but also helps in marketing the app organically. A community-driven approach encourages user retention, as individuals are more likely to return to applications where they have established social connections.
Real-time collaboration features are also on the rise, particularly in applications designed for productivity and project management. These capabilities facilitate teamwork by allowing multiple users to collaborate simultaneously on projects. Whether through shared documents or live feedback, real-time collaboration enhances productivity and communication among users. As remote work becomes the norm, such features are invaluable in supporting efficient teamwork across distances.
User feedback mechanisms are increasingly integrated into mobile applications to understand user preferences better. By prompting users to rate features, provide suggestions, or report issues, developers can gain insights into areas needing improvement. This user-centric approach fosters a sense of community and ownership, as users feel their opinions are valued and impactful. As a result, applications evolve in alignment with user needs, enhancing overall satisfaction.
As we look towards the future, the integration of blockchain technology in mobile apps is a trend poised for growth. This technology offers enhanced security and transparency, making it ideal for applications involving transactions and sensitive data. Users are becoming more conscious of how their data is handled; thus, apps incorporating blockchain may gain an edge in terms of trust and reliability.
In conclusion, the incorporation of AI, machine learning, AR, gamification, and various other advanced features defines the current landscape of mobile applications. These trends reflect the evolving expectations of users and the role of technology in shaping experiences. Developers must remain agile in their approach, continually adapting to the changing demands of the mobile landscape. By prioritizing user experience and integrating innovative features, app developers can ensure sustained engagement and satisfaction in an increasingly competitive market.
The future of application features is bright, fueled by creativity and technology. As developers explore new frontiers in user engagement and functionality, users can look forward to an enhanced mobile experience that evolves with their needs. Each advancement paves the way for a more interconnected and user-friendly digital world.